Abstract

Synthesis and antimycobacterial activity of Cu (II) complexes containing thiosemicarbazones ligand

Copper (II) thiosemicarbazone complexes derived from simple thiosemicarbazone. The compounds were characterised using various spectroscopic and analytical techniques, including NMR spectroscopy, mass spectrometry, infrared spectroscopy and elemental analysis. The copper (II) complexes were screened for in vitro antitubercular activity. Incorporation of the copper (II) centre into thiosemicarbazone scaffolds enhanced their efficacy against the Mycobacterium tuberculosis while this trend was not observed for the selected simple thiosemicarbazones against the Mycobacterium tuberculosis virulent strain NCSMTB
